Guide to cheap flights from Adelaide to Darwin

Leaving Adelaide for the tropical north offers a dramatic transition from the refined elegance of the south to the rugged, multicultural heart of the Top End. Darwin serves as a captivating gateway to some of the most significant natural wonders and ancient cultural landscapes in the region. Visitors are drawn to its unique blend of military history, lively outdoor markets, and a relaxed waterfront lifestyle that feels distinct from any other capital. Beyond the city limits, the proximity to world-class national parks provides an opportunity to experience vast wetlands, towering sandstone escarpments, and a heritage that stretches back tens of thousands of years, making it a bucket-list destination for those seeking both adventure and a deep connection to the land.

The journey between these two cities covers a distance of approximately 2,610 km, cutting directly through the vast interior of the continent. A direct flight typically takes about 3 hours and 40 minutes, departing from Adelaide Airport and arriving at Darwin International Airport. Several domestic carriers operate this route, with Qantas, Virgin Australia, and Jetstar providing regular services that cater to different schedules. For those looking to experience the best weather, the dry season between May and October is widely considered the ideal time to visit, as the humidity is lower and the days are consistently clear and sunny. While flights are available year-round, booking a mid-week departure can often provide a more seamless travel experience during the peak northern tourist season.

Darwin International Airport (DRW)

Upon arrival, visitors land at Darwin International Airport, which operates as the sole 24-hour international gateway for the Northern Territory. The airfield is located about 8 km northeast of the city and shares its runways with a military base. This terminal is designed to handle the humid tropical climate and offers various vehicle rental services for those planning to explore the nearby national parks.

Darwin International Airport (DRW)

Darwin International Airport is the sole facility providing domestic and international air services for the city. Situated roughly 13 km from the central business district, this site shares its runways with military operations, though the civilian terminal is a modern, integrated space designed for efficiency. The building features a single-terminal layout that manages both arrivals and departures, making navigation straightforward for those arriving on a 3-hour and 40-minute flight from the south. Facilities within this transport hub include a variety of retail outlets and dining options that reflect the local culture. Ground transport is readily available outside the main doors, with shuttle buses and taxis providing a quick 15-minute journey into the heart of the city. Because the terminal is open 24 hours, it accommodates the late-night arrivals common to this specific cross-continental route.

How is the weather in Darwin compared to Adelaide?
While in Adelaide temperatures can reach an average of 23º ºC in summer, Darwin's temperatures can rise to 29º ºC during the hot season. In winter, however, weather data show around 24º ºC in Darwin, compared to the 12º ºC average in Adelaide.
